Full Job Description
Roles & Responsibilities:
Work with product engineering to develop reliability requirements, establish a reliability plan and perform appropriate analyses to ensure that new products meet all of the requirements.
Work with the project teams to develop a reliability plan to document tasks, methods, tools, tests and analyses that are required for the success of new products.
ssist engineering teams to achieve warranty reduction and improve customer satisfaction by leading quality efforts on problem identification, failure root cause analysis, corrective action development and resolution verification.
May participate and/or conduct training and workshops on quality and reliability engineering, robustness, and statistics as necessary within product engineering.
Participate in product design and reliability reviews during new product development to ensure robustness of product design and manufacturing processes.
Perform statistical data analysis, regression modeling, Weibull Analysis, hazard analysis, reliability growth assessment and prediction, target setting, warranty trend analysis and spending forecast for new products.
Perform Design FMEAs on all new products and recommend design changes to improve product reliability.
Work with Manufacturing to evaluate and qualify new technology and new processes implemented in manufacturing.
Conduct reliability testing on new and existing products. Highly Accelerated Life Testing and Highly Accelerated Stress Testing to identify product failure modes. Validate and track product requirements through development.
Conduct accelerated life testing on both the component and system level to provide feedback on design life which can be used to evaluate failure and safety risks within the project.
